Sometimes being correct about the Cowboys gives me a stomach ache. 

Romo was not healed from the start of the season.  A new throwing motion with less velocity and less accuracy is bothersome news for 2013 (and this was prior to the bruised Ribs against the Giants.)
The Boys look like the "same ole same ole" as related to the rest of the league. 
8-8 seems about right if Romo's back improves during the year. 

Offense:    I was upset with myself during the first quarter vs. the Giants when I had forgotten that part of the news conference announcing Bill Callahan.  The most important and disappointing parts was the comment that went like this.
" We will run the same offense, I will just help with play calling"
How did I miss it?  The same offense that Ed Reed and others made comments about being surprising simplistic!   

The equation=Run into the line twice then pray for Romo on 3rd down.  If your behind turn Romo loose in the 2 min offense and score. Well if Romo is inaccurate, they will not win 9 games.

Defense:  It looks better, I am not sold on the coverage when a team spreads the field.  Eli seemed to throw at will when he went to a hurry up.   
Ware is hidden on the corner so far, the positive is Lee, Carter and Church are flying to the ball.
